Exhibitions
A Thought on Observation
October 2010
As part of the Black History Week, Sanna Jarl-Hansson’spresented her work which explores questions surrounding the notions of cultural division and collation in relation to the individual.
Faces – The 21st Century
August-September 2010
A premiere exhibition with work by the artists, Jonathan Bradbury, Lynn Hatzius, Rowan Newton, Froso Papadimitriou, Trevor Simmons, that reflected society on the aftermath of the millennium, exploring the conformities and contradictions of the eras in a path through time.

Illustrated talks
Brixton Black Panthers and the Olive Morris Story
October 2010
Testimony from surviving members of the Brixton Black Panthers plus rare video footage and photographs was shown to reveal stories of the British civil rights struggle in the 1970’s.
